Susannah Leydon-Davis


Susannah Leydon-Davis is a New Zealand badminton player. In 2014, she competed at the Commonwealth Games in Glasgow, Scotland.

Career

Originally from Hamilton, Leydon-Davis attended Hillcrest High School and was Sports Captain in 2009. In 2015 she graduated from the University of Waikato with a Bachelor of Management Studies. She competed at the Commonwealth Games in Glasgow July 2014. Susannah competes in the mixed doubles with her brother Oliver, and they have actively been New Zealand representatives. She and her brother, won the mixed doubles gold medal at the 2014 Oceania Badminton Championships. Teamed up with Kevin Dennerly-Minturn she won the Waikato International tournament in the mixed doubles event.
